Pact is an International NGO with an office in Kenya among several other offices across the world, which enables systematic solutions that allow those who are poor and marginalized to earn a dignified living, be healthy and take part in the benefits that nature provides.
 
Pact accomplishes this by strengthening local capacity, forging effective governance systems and transforming markets into a force for development.

PEACE III is a five-year project (2014-2019), funded by USAID and implemented by Pact.

The aim of PEACE III is to support EA regional and US government goals in improving stability along EA’s border regions by strengthening the horizontal and vertical linkages within and between local, national and regional conflict management actors.

PEACE III will work with local implementing partners to build capacity of community peace leaders and organizations while strengthening inter-personal and inter-communal collaboration at all levels

Job Summary: The Driver is responsible for driving assigned vehicles to transport Pact personnel and goods.

She/he takes care of the passengers, the property in his/her custody and ensures that the vehicle is insured and properly maintained.

She/he also helps with supporting logistical coordination for field activities, and makes cash disbursements to support field activities.

She/he reports accidents immediately to the supervisor.
